On a hot Saturday afternoon, our WAttention editorial staff visited this lovely patisserie hiding in the residential area in Ebisu, Tokyo. Before opening his first pastry shop in Ebisu, the chef, Toshi Yoroizuka, has spent 8 years learning pastry-making across 4 countries in Europe, including restaurants with Michelin Stars. The small pastry shop is filled with delicate and mouth-watering pastries! Even the takeout bag is stylish. フロマージュ・ドゥーブル (Fromage Double) 490 Yen ムッシュ・キタノ (Mousse au chocolat) 500 Yen Info |
